Beadle's Dime Song Book No. 1 by Various
"Beadle's Dime Song Book No. 1" by Various is a collection of new and popular comic and sentimental songs written in the mid-19th century. This compilation features a diverse range of songs reflecting themes of love, home, and nostalgia, intertwining both humor and sentimentality to engage the reader. The book serves as a snapshot of the musical culture of its time, illustrating the social sentiments and experiences prevalent in an era marked
by significant change. The opening of this songbook introduces various titles, indicating a blend of popular themes and styles in 19th-century music. It features well-known songs such as “Gentle Annie” and “Nelly Gray,” showcasing the emotional pull of lost love and longing for home. Each song highlights the depth of feelings associated with love, loss, and memory, often evoking imagery tied to nature and domestic life. The chapter serves as both a directory and a testament to the enduring appeal of these songs, promising readers an emotional journey through the melodies and lyrics of an important period in American music history.
